Transaction 34129bdd89c215c13bc2988bc5ee81297408002f0da28e35426c1681b5d0a6ee

20 Input
2 Outputs
  • 34129bdd89c215c13bc2988bc5ee81297408002f0da28e35426c1681b5d0a6ee:0
  • value  433701
    address  3KPdKCx4LPpqQLs7Q5VByWumXDJckxSbaG
  • 34129bdd89c215c13bc2988bc5ee81297408002f0da28e35426c1681b5d0a6ee:1
  • value  15589790
    address  3351GvA958FLgYLNhaPXtJssasbQsTLprr